index 960bef8ce45254f4e7c788f012ec2e5fd7623c62..b934af876ca2bde9d44397015f95c7ce70953bd5 100644 (file)
--- a/test.c
+++ b/test.c
static const char source[] =
"MODULE Test;"
"TYPE"
- " MyArr = ARRAY 3 OF INTEGER;"
- " MyArrPtr = POINTER TO MyArr;"
" MyRec = POINTER TO MyRecDesc;"
- " MyRecDesc = RECORD next : POINTER TO MyRecDesc END;"
- ""
+ " MyRecDesc = RECORD"
+ " a : INTEGER;"
+ " END;"
"VAR"
- " a : MyArr;"
- " b : MyArrPtr;"
- " c : MyRec;"
- " d : MyRecDesc;"
- ""
- "BEGIN"
+ " r : MyRec;"
+ "BEGIN;"
+ " r := NIL;"
+ " r.a := 1;"
"END Test."
;